adaptive

Intermediate (B1)

IPA: //əˈdæptɪv//

KK: /əˈdæptɪv/

adjective
Definition

Able to change or adjust easily to different conditions or needs. This word describes something that can be modified to fit various situations, like clothing made for children with special requirements.


Example

The adaptive features of the software make it easier for users with disabilities to navigate.

Root Explanation

Adaptive → It is formed from "adapt" (from Latin "adaptare", meaning to adjust or fit) and "-ive" (meaning having the nature of). The word "adaptive" means having the nature of adjusting or fitting to new conditions.
